WWE 2K25has revealed the details of its season pass, announcing which new characters it’ll release monthly following its March release. Building on itslaunch roster,WWE 2K25will receive a series of DLC character packs throughout the year. Each one will contain a handful of new playable wrestlers, along with the occasional celebrity guest. Barring any surprise superstar announcements (which I wouldn’t totally count out),WWE 2K25’s Season Pass is expected to expand the roster by over 20 characters throughout the remainder of the year.
Players can purchase each ofWWE 2K25’s DLC character packs individually, in case they’re interested in a particular character or theme. However,they can also purchase the Season Pass to gain access to all five packsas soon as they’re released. The Season Pass can be purchased separately (price TBA), but it’s also included with the Deadman and Bloodlineeditions ofWWE 2K25. For now, here’s everything we know aboutWWE 2K25’s planned DLC, including which wrestlers are included in which pack.

TheNew Wave PackisWWE 2K25’s first planned DLC, expected for release in May 2025. It’s also tied for the most stacked DLC, with five characters planned:
This pack is dedicated to new signings: each of the four wrestlers announced for it signed to WWE in 2024, and made their in-ring debuts late that year or in early 2025. It’s likely they just missed the deadline to be included in the game at launch, but will be added later as their roles in real-life WWE expand.

Dunk & Destruction Pack
Coming June 2025
Up next is theDunk & Destruction Pack,due out in June 2025. This is probably the most concentrated when it comes to non-wrestlers; it’s also the one we know the least about. Only two playable characters have been confirmed for this second DLC:
The theming is clear here, when it comes to wrestlers:both Abyss and Great Khali are renowned for their incredible strengthand stature, able to cause lots of “destruction” in the ring. That’s just alliterative with “dunk,” which, of course, represents the three NBA stars yet to be announced for this second DLC. It may not be clear what the inspiration behind this pack was, but if nothing else, it might be fun to see how Jokic handles a TLC match against prime Undertaker.

Saturday Night’s Main Event Pack
Coming November 2025
Our final planned DLC pack forWWE 2K25is theSaturday Night’s Main Event Pack,scheduled for release in November. We’re going back even further in time here, to the mid-80s and early ’90s, the advent of WWE’s weeklySaturday Night’s Main Eventbroadcasts.Since the format has returned, this pack celebrates the superstars who initiatedSaturday Night’s Main Event, and isheadlined by Jesse Ventura.
This marks some superstars' mainline debut in theWWEvideo game series,including Mr. Wonderful. Also known as Paul Orndorff, he signed with the WWF in 1983, where he was managed by “Rowdy” Roddy Piper. With Piper, he went up against Hulk Hogan and Mr. T in a tag team match as the main event at the very firstWrestleMania. He retired permanently in 2000, after which he turned to training, and was inducted into the WWE Hall of Fame in 2009.

This is also the2Kdebut of Tito Santana, who signed with the WWF in 1979. A two-time Intercontinental Champion, he’s also known as one half of Strike Force (along with Rick Martel) - also two-time champions. A 2004 inductee into the WWE Hall of Fame, Santana now works the independent circuit, following a stint as a physical education and Spanish teacher at various schools around the state of New Jersey.
